Output 84f52c8808a368516589c5b011ba25e13124fc837b4ce2ee9bff3d36db2107bb:1

value
1233105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e010a5e9fbcc7d1bb89dcded0f6f4756a9663c9c OP_EQUAL
address
3N7mEF7YqtZpQaVsq9fxPCxqGoiNjU68iY
transaction
84f52c8808a368516589c5b011ba25e13124fc837b4ce2ee9bff3d36db2107bb
confirmations
249597
spent
true